State Medicaid Superlatives—The Most Elaborate & Dynamic Of 2017
Covering 25% of all mental health treatment services, Medicaid is “the largest payer” in the U.S. behavioral health system. But in one respect, that is a misnomer—in reality Medicaid is a collection of 50 payers with 50 separate partnerships between each state and the federal government. With 50 unique ways of providing health care to vulnerable populations, the Medicaid programs are as diverse as the states themselves.
